Since I'm not a fan of vinegar in even trace amounts, I feel lucky to have found a couple of commercial sauces that fill that requirement, and they do so admirably IMHO.

Pico Pica is available only in the far West, or online through Mexgrocer.com and Amazon. Herdez is distributed nationwide, as far as I can tell.
